Jordanian cuisine is known for its rich flavors, fresh ingredients, and traditional dishes. Popular foods include “mansaf,” the national dish made of lamb, rice, and yogurt sauce, often served during special occasions. “Maklouba,” a one-pot dish of rice, vegetables, and meat, is another favorite. “Falafel” and “hummus” are widely enjoyed as appetizers or snacks. “Knafeh,” a sweet pastry with cheese and syrup, is a beloved dessert, showcasing the sweet and savory balance of Jordanian food.
